IEXA.DE vs. EL49.DE
IEXA.DE (iShares EUR Corporate Bond ex-Financials UCITS ETF EUR Acc) and EL49.DE (Deka iBoxx EUR Liquid Corporates Diversified UCITS ETF) are both European Corporate Bonds funds - IEXA.DE tracks the Bloomberg Euro Corporate ex-Financials Bond while EL49.DE tracks the iBoxx® EUR Liquid Corporates Diversified. Both are passively managed. Over the past 3 years, IEXA.DE returned 4.16%/yr vs 4.59%/yr for EL49.DE. Their correlation of 0.85 suggests significant overlap in exposure. Both charge a 0.20% expense ratio.
